    Based on the positive reviews, we assumed this was a professional bakery that did quality work. However, these are the birthday cupcakes that were made for my child's birthday costing $24 for 6. These were not acceptable and no pride or care was put into making these. We were left scrambling last minute to find something else more suitable for a special occasion. Very, very disappointed given I could have done a better job baking these. I wish I had gone to pick these up rather than my husband who really didn't inspect these closely before leaving the bakery, because they would have been left right on the counter. Needless to say I will never be using this bakery's services again nor recommending them.

    Salty Disappointment…read more Normally wedding cakes are sweet, but my own experience with Jenny Layne Bakery (JLB) for my wedding cake was salty. It started out well enough; Jenny is kind and cares about her work (we met her at an open house event). I chose her because of her accolades, her beautiful cakes on Instagram, the fact that my MOH enjoyed working with her, and because she was my venue's preferred baker. All good things, right? So I thought. My now-husband, parents, and I tasted boxed up cupcakes instead of an in person cake tasting post-Covid. I wasn't impressed by most of the cupcake flavors, but it was too late since we'd already booked with JLB, and I thought, "At least the final cake will be beautiful." After I researched wedding cakes, Jenny and I personally worked on the wedding cake design together. I was excited with what we came up with! A lovely white cake with royal blue ribbon, an edible "C" crest for my new last name, and some classy pearl necklaces wrapped around two tiers to match the one I'd wear that day. Come wedding day, I saw the wedding cake for the first time at the reception and was surprised to learn that there wasn't one but two things wrong with the cake. First, the "C" crest was missing. Second, the pearl necklaces had slid off the rims of the tiers in several places, so they were more pearl "L" shaped (see pictures below). After my honeymoon, I reached out to JLB and nicely asked what happened, sending pictures of the cake design vs. the final reception result. Jenny herself let me know that it was "a sad cake" and asked how she could make it up to me as she understood she couldn't redo my wedding cake. She also explained that the delivery person dropped the edible crest, which she forgot to tell me earlier, and it seemed the pearls had melted in the sun. Apparently 72 degrees is too hot for a professional four tier wedding cake, but not a one tier groom's cake my mother's friend made that had traveled over 250 miles in a car without an issue. Thus, I asked for a refund. A few days later, Jenny's assistant let me know they could not give a refund because "Walters does not offer refunds and because we do not handle the financials as it pertains to the wedding packages." Aka because I went with the Walters Weddings vendor package and preferred bakery, the bakery can't do a refund directly, as we paid the Walters Wedding venue for the cake. Therefore, Walters would need to refund the bakery for the cake (or something like that). JLB could offer a new anniversary tier or $50 in store credit to be used by the end of the year. Mind you, JLB did not bother to reach out about the "C" crest being damaged even though they knew it was upon arrival. The venue placed the cake where they normally do as this bakery and venue have worked together countless times with Jenny Layne Bakery listed as its preferred vendor. I reached out to the venue's GM and told her the story. She said she'd see what she could do. Nearly three weeks later, I followed up with the venue GM again. Then Jenny reached out and offered the same $50, but now as a refund, store credit, or an anniversary tier. We opted for the $50 refund, a salty disappointment to what I was expecting to be a sweet and beautiful wedding cake. If you've made it to the end of this review, please know Jenny Layne Bakery doesn't come recommended from me because they made not one but two mistakes, and because of the lackluster consolidation offered. I chose this bakery primarily for the aesthetics - and that's where they fell short *twice* with my wedding cake. So I'm coming home with $50 to make up for this "sad cake." Brides to be, something will go wrong on your wedding day. But ensure your vendors care enough about you as a customer to try to right their wrongs, as I experienced with my hair stylist, but not with my bakery.
